DEVICES and SOFTWARE:

Finale 2014.5, and Trial of Finale 25, a fast system (Samsung Laptop, w/i7 processor, solid state 500g hard drive, Windows 10 64-bit), Yamaha YPG-535 Keyboard, and Yamaha Pedals (FC5 and FC4A)

We Updated ALL drivers... Yamaha Windows 10, 64 bit, midi driver; any Finale updates, and any Samsung updates.

We even learned that the YPG535 pedals will reverse polarity if plugged in and out while the keyboard is on, requiring a power on and off of the keyboard. This fixes this reversal  of polarity. :)

FINALLY, FINALE issue: When we go into Hyperscribe and click Tap... Listen (if listen doesn't detect just restart finale or keyboards) ... Listen detects... click on the Hyperscribe quick tool... click on the measure to "Hyperscribe"... Start the quarter note tapping of the pedal... No matter how hard we try, and yes we have clicked "avoid unwanted rests", the are UNWANTED RESTS in front of, and sometimes in back of a quarter note or eighth note...
